Engineering General Contracting builds a comprehensive service platform to achieve integrated project management.
As an important model in modern project management, Engineering, Procurement, and Construction (EPC) integrates design, construction, material procurement, and other related processes, bringing together disparate stages under a single platform for coordinated management. This approach achieves end-to-end integrated management of engineering projects. Not only does this model enhance the overall efficiency of engineering projects, but it also enables effective cost control and boosts project competitiveness.
In recent years, as the state has continuously raised its standards for the quality and efficiency of engineering projects, the Engineering, Procurement, and Construction (EPC) model has gradually gained prominence and is now widely applied across various types of projects. By adopting advanced management principles and technological approaches, EPC contractors are better able to coordinate resources from all stakeholders, ensuring project schedules and quality while mitigating risks, thereby providing strong support for the successful execution of projects.
Under the EPC (Engineering, Procurement, and Construction) model, all participating parties can collaborate more effectively, achieve information sharing and resource integration, avoid the drawbacks of multiple overlapping management structures in traditional project management, and reduce communication costs and coordination challenges. At the same time, the EPC model also fosters collaborative development within the engineering industry, enhancing the overall efficiency and standards of the sector.
In summary, as a modern project management approach, engineering general contracting provides crucial support for the smooth implementation of engineering projects. As this model continues to be refined and widely adopted, it is believed that engineering general contracting will bring more opportunities and challenges to the development of the engineering industry.
